Flatrock Manor
Flatrock AFC home is looking for a
proactive and detail-oriented Corporate Administrative Assistant
to provide essential support across our organization. In this role, you’ll manage a variety of administrative tasks—from handling mail and drafting documents to maintaining records, coordinating companywide meetings, and overseeing key trackers and software systems. If you thrive in a fast-paced environment and enjoy keeping operations running smoothly, we’d love to hear from you.
Duties and Responsibilities
Retrieve mail and distribute accordingly
Draft letters and documents; collect and analyze information
File and retrieve HR and corporate records, documents, and reports as needed
Assist with preparing for companywide meetings
Complete miscellaneous errands as needed, including but not limited to:
Picking up or dropping items
Oversee spreadsheets for various projects, including but not limited to:
Pop ins
Guardian calls tracker
Use various software, including word processing, spreadsheets, database, and presentation software
Prepare and format information for internal and external distribution
Maintain Microsoft TEAMS application as an administrator to add and remove users to home
Oversee vehicle tracker and complete Secretary of State renewals
Complete special order request purchases as assigned
Complete supply orders
Complete Amazon wish list as sent by CSAs
Assist the Community Support Advocate Manager with any Oakley or companywide events as needed
Maintain positive, open, and supportive relationship with all management and staff
Maintain and advocate for all Flatrock residents’ rights
Complete any additional tasks assigned
Qualifications
Must have High School diploma or equivalent
Reliable transportation
Valid driver's license
3+ years of experience in secretarial and/or administrative support roles
Advanced proficiency in Microsoft Office Suite (Word, Excel, PowerPoint, Outlook)
Strong organizational skills with meticulous attention to detail
Proven ability to manage multiple tasks and produce error-free work under pressure
